The contact owns a 2018 Audi Q3. The contact stated that on numerous occasions, the check engine warning light intermittently illuminated. The contact then stated that while driving at undisclosed speed, the vehicle hesitated and stalled. The vehicle was towed to the dealer where it was diagnosed that the gas cylinder, fuel needed to be flushed and two unknown parts needed to be replaced. The vehicle was repaired however, the failure recurred. The vehicle was taken back to the dealer where the failure could not be duplicated. The vehicle was then taken to an independent mechanic where it was diagnosed that the fuel needed to be flushed. The vehicle was not repaired. The manufacturer was not notified of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 62,352.
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Audi) is recalling certain 2016-2018 Audi Q3 vehicles equipped with LED headlights. An inoperable front turn signal may not illuminate an indicator, failing to alert the driver to the issue.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 108, "Lamps, Reflective Devices, and Associated Equipment."
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: Without an indicator informing the driver of an inoperable turn signal, the driver may turn or change lanes without a signal, increasing the risk of crash.
Remedy: Audi will notify owners, and dealers will update the body control module (BCM), free of charge. The recall began June 21, 2019. Owners may contact Audi customer service at 1-800-253-2834. Audi's number for this recall is 97DK.
